Mary Ellen Ward 1838–1902 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 28 May 1838

Birth Location: Ohio

Death Date: 3 May 1902

Death Location: Milwaukee, Wisconsin

Father: John Ward

Mother: Polly None

Spouse(s): John Grisim

Children(s): John Grisim

In 1838, Mary Ellen Ward entered the world in Ohio, born to John Rufus Ward And Polly. In 1860, Mary Ellen Ward resided in Milwaukee Ward 8, Milwaukee, Milwaukee, Wisconsin,. In 1880, Mary Ellen Ward resided in Milwaukee, Milwaukee, Wisconsin, USA. Mary Ellen Ward married John Grisim, and had children including John Clarence Grisim. Mary Ellen Ward passed away in 1902 in Milwaukee, Wisconsin.
